Understanding Magnetic Field Regulations
When planning to carry magnets in your luggage, it’s essential to be aware of the magnetic field restrictions imposed by airlines and regulatory authorities. For air travel, any package or magnet that generates a magnetic field exceeding 0.00525 gauss measured at a distance of 4.5 meters (15 feet) from its surface is prohibited from flying. If the magnetic field falls below this threshold, you are permitted to include them in either your checked or carry-on luggage. This regulation primarily aims to protect the aircraft’s navigational systems, as strong magnetic fields can interfere with flight equipment.
Packing Magnets for Air Travel
When packing magnets for your journey, the goal is to minimize their magnetic impact. A recommended method is to wrap each magnet individually in non-magnetic materials, such as cardboard or plastic boxes. This practice not only secures the magnets from damage but also mitigates their magnetic influence. After wrapping, it’s advisable to place these individual packages in a larger, sturdy box equipped with cushioning materials. This added protection helps ensure the safe transport of your magnets while adhering to safety regulations.
- Recommended Packing Materials:
- Non-magnetic materials (cardboard, plastic)
- Sturdy box with cushioning (bubble wrap, foam)
Advanced Techniques for Rare Earth Magnets
For those transporting rare earth magnets, which are significantly stronger and may require special handling, employing magnetic shielding techniques is vital. Using materials with high magnetic permeability, such as iron or steel, creates a protective barrier around the magnets. This magnetic shield can effectively redirect magnetic field lines, thus reducing the field strength outside the package. This strategy not only complies with air transport regulations but also enhances safety for all passengers on board.
- Magnetic Shielding Materials:
- Iron
- Steel
Traveling with Specialty Magnets
If you are considering bringing magnets designed for specific activities, such as fishing magnets, rest assured that they are generally approved for travel. The Transportation Security Administration (TSA) lists magnets as acceptable items in both carry-on and checked luggage. However, as with any traveling item, it’s critical to ensure that the cumulative magnetic field strength does not exceed prescribed limits, which can impede navigation systems if set too high.
